fn is_label_coordinate_in_path(point: crate::model::LayoutPoint, d_attr: &str) -> bool {
    // Mermaid `@11.12.2`:
    // - `packages/mermaid/src/utils.ts:isLabelCoordinateInPath`
    // - `packages/mermaid/src/rendering-util/rendering-elements/edges.js`
    //
    // This is intentionally a very rough heuristic: it rounds the mid point and checks whether
    // either the rounded x or y shows up in the rounded SVG path `d` string.
    let rounded_x = point.x.round() as i64;
    let rounded_y = point.y.round() as i64;

    fn re_float_with_decimals() -> &'static regex::Regex {
        use std::sync::OnceLock;
        static RE: OnceLock<regex::Regex> = OnceLock::new();
        RE.get_or_init(|| regex::Regex::new(r"(\d+\.\d+)").expect("regex must compile"))
    }
    let re = re_float_with_decimals();
    let sanitized_d = re.replace_all(d_attr, |caps: &regex::Captures<'_>| {
        let v = caps
            .get(1)
            .and_then(|m| m.as_str().parse::<f64>().ok())
            .unwrap_or(0.0);
        format!("{}", v.round() as i64)
    });

    sanitized_d.contains(&rounded_x.to_string()) || sanitized_d.contains(&rounded_y.to_string())
}

fn calc_label_position(points: &[crate::model::LayoutPoint]) -> Option<(f64, f64)> {
    if points.is_empty() {
        return None;
    }
    if points.len() == 1 {
        return Some((points[0].x, points[0].y));
    }

    let mut total = 0.0;
    for i in 1..points.len() {
        let dx = points[i].x - points[i - 1].x;
        let dy = points[i].y - points[i - 1].y;
        total += (dx * dx + dy * dy).sqrt();
    }
    let mut remaining = total / 2.0;
    for i in 1..points.len() {
        let p0 = &points[i - 1];
        let p1 = &points[i];
        let dx = p1.x - p0.x;
        let dy = p1.y - p0.y;
        let seg = (dx * dx + dy * dy).sqrt();
        if seg == 0.0 {
            continue;
        }
        if seg < remaining {
            remaining -= seg;
            continue;
        }
        let t = (remaining / seg).clamp(0.0, 1.0);
        return Some((p0.x + t * dx, p0.y + t * dy));
    }
    Some((points.last()?.x, points.last()?.y))
}

        fn roughjs46_next_f64(seed: &mut u32) -> f64 {
            if *seed == 0 {
                // Mermaid (Rough.js) falls back to `Math.random()` when seed=0. We keep our SVG
                // stable in that case by returning 0, which yields `divergePoint=0.2`.
                return 0.0;
            }
            // Rough.js v4.6.6 (bin/math.js):
            //   this.seed = Math.imul(48271, this.seed)
            //   return ((2**31 - 1) & this.seed) / 2**31
            let prod = seed.wrapping_mul(48_271);
            *seed = prod & 0x7fff_ffff;
            (*seed as f64) / 2_147_483_648.0
        }

        fn roughjs46_diverge_point(seed: &mut u32) -> f64 {
            0.2 + roughjs46_next_f64(seed) * 0.2
        }

        fn roughjs46_double_line_path_d(
            seed: &mut u32,
            x0: f64,
            y0: f64,
            x1: f64,
            y1: f64,
        ) -> String {
            let mut out = String::new();
            let dx = x1 - x0;
            let dy = y1 - y0;

            for _ in 0..2 {
                let d = roughjs46_diverge_point(seed);
                // Rough.js `_line()` continues to call into `_offsetOpt()` even when `roughness=0`
                // (the random terms get multiplied by zero, but the PRNG state still advances).
                //
                // In Rough.js v4.6.6 `_line()` uses:
                // - 2 random() calls for `midDispX/midDispY` offsetOpt
                // - 2 random() calls for moveTo (x1/y1)
                // - 6 random() calls for bcurveTo (cp1/cp2/x2/y2)
                // Total: 10 random() calls after divergePoint.
                for _ in 0..10 {
                    let _ = roughjs46_next_f64(seed);
                }
                let cx1 = x0 + dx * d;
                let cy1 = y0 + dy * d;
                let cx2 = x0 + dx * 2.0 * d;
                let cy2 = y0 + dy * 2.0 * d;
                let _ = write!(
                    &mut out,
                    "M{} {} C{} {}, {} {}, {} {} ",
                    x0, y0, cx1, cy1, cx2, cy2, x1, y1
                );
            }

            out.trim_end().to_string()
        }

        fn rough_line_path_d(seed: u64, x0: f64, y0: f64, x1: f64, y1: f64) -> String {
            if seed == 0 {
                return fallback_rough_line_path_d(x0, y0, x1, y1);
            }
            let mut s = seed as u32;
            roughjs46_double_line_path_d(&mut s, x0, y0, x1, y1)
        }

        fn rough_rect_border_path_d(seed: u64, x0: f64, y0: f64, x1: f64, y1: f64) -> String {
            let w = (x1 - x0).max(0.0);
            let h = (y1 - y0).max(0.0);
            if seed == 0 {
                return fallback_rough_rect_border_path_d(x0, y0, x1, y1);
            }
            let mut s = seed as u32;

            // Rough.js v4.6.6 renderer.rectangle -> polygon -> linearPath:
            //   segments: (x,y)->(x+w,y)->(x+w,y+h)->(x,y+h)->(x,y)
            let mut out = String::new();
            let x2 = x0 + w;
            let y2 = y0 + h;

            let segs = [
                (x0, y0, x2, y0),
                (x2, y0, x2, y2),
                (x2, y2, x0, y2),
                (x0, y2, x0, y0),
            ];
            for (ax, ay, bx, by) in segs {
                let d = roughjs46_double_line_path_d(&mut s, ax, ay, bx, by);
                out.push_str(&d);
                out.push(' ');
            }

            out.trim_end().to_string()
        }

        fn roughjs46_rect_fill_path_d(x0: f64, y0: f64, x1: f64, y1: f64) -> String {
            format!(
                "M{} {} L{} {} L{} {} L{} {}",
                x0, y0, x1, y0, x1, y1, x0, y1
            )
        }

fn er_unified_marker_id(diagram_id: &str, diagram_type: &str, upstream_marker: &str) -> String {
    let upstream_marker = upstream_marker.trim();
    let (base, suffix) = if let Some(v) = upstream_marker.strip_suffix("_START") {
        (v, "Start")
    } else if let Some(v) = upstream_marker.strip_suffix("_END") {
        (v, "End")
    } else {
        return upstream_marker.to_string();
    };

    let marker_type = match base {
        "ONLY_ONE" => "onlyOne",
        "ZERO_OR_ONE" => "zeroOrOne",
        "ONE_OR_MORE" => "oneOrMore",
        "ZERO_OR_MORE" => "zeroOrMore",
        "MD_PARENT" => "mdParent",
        _ => return upstream_marker.to_string(),
    };

    format!("{diagram_id}_{diagram_type}-{marker_type}{suffix}")
}
